Spicy Tomato Chicken Casserole

This is a quick and easy dish. Conventional oven or microwave baking can be used. Tastes sooooooo good, it'll make your tongue slap your brains out! 'Rotel' is the name for the mixture of diced tomatoes with green chile peppers. It is sold in most grocery stores in the canned tomato or Mexican foods section.

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
In a medium bowl combine the tomatoes and soup and mix together. Set aside.
Step 2
In a lightly greased 2 quart microwave-safe casserole dish layer 1/3 of the tortilla chips, 1/2 of the chicken, 1/2 of the tomato/soup mixture and 1/3 of the cheese. Repeat layers, then top with the remaining tortilla chips and cheese.
Step 3
Microwave: Cover dish with lid or wax paper. Microwave for 7 minutes. Remove lid long enough to release steam, then microwave for another 4 minutes.
Step 4
Conventional Oven: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Cover dish with lid or aluminum foil and bake in the preheated oven for 30 minutes.

Ingredients

  • 1 (10.75 ounce) can condensed cream of celery soup
  • 1 (10 ounce) can diced tomatoes with green chile peppers
  • 1 (10 ounce) package nacho-flavor tortilla chips
  • 4 skinless, boneless, chicken breast halves, cooked
  • 1 pound processed cheese food (eg. Velveeta), sliced
